Quebec, eastern province of Canada. Constituting nearly one-sixth of Canada’s total land area, Quebec is the largest of Canada’s 10 provinces in area and is second only to Ontario in population. Its capital, Quebec city, is the oldest city in Canada. The only fortified city north of Mexico, one cannot visit Québec City without admiring the fortified walls and ramparts which were the city’s defensive system built between 1608 and 1871. Today, the fortifications of Québec consist of 4 gates, 3 Martello towers, the Citadelle, and 4.6 km of ramparts, complete with cannons, which encircle ...Quebec Summary. Château Frontenac, château-style hotel in historic Old Québec, built by the Canadian Pacific Railroad Company in 1893 and designed by American architect Bruce Price. Nov 14, 2022 · Since the 1860s the building has been home to the Quebec Literary and Historical Society, the oldest learned society in Canada. Today the building is a cultural centre, devoted to the history of the English-speaking community in Québec City. The Society’s library is one of the most remarkable interior spaces in Old Québec. Nov 23, 2023 · Adding a few items to your travel bag before heading to Old Québec will help boost your ecofriendly travel quotient. Bring a reusable water bottle and coffee cup and use them in cafés and restaurants to avoid the need for disposables. For picnics and takeout meals, pack a few cloth bags and a set of utensils rolled into a cloth napkin.
